- First-aid room: ground floor, east corridor of the Tellvane Annexe, next to the loading bay. Show the new starter the location, the defibrillator cabinet, and the incident log. Confirm the eyewash station is stocked. Facilities desk restocks supplies every Monday. Any usage must be logged before end of shift. The room stays locked outside office hours; the keypad accepts the code below.

staff pass of kawip-hawef = bdg-QLP-2

[ ] Spare parts drop – Kestrel Ridge relay site

Heads up: the run from Polden Works brings one crate of pump seals and two boxed actuators. Check the crate seal isn't broken and tick items off the packing slip before the driver leaves — no exceptions this time. Then have whoever signs complete the hand-over instruction listed below.

handover note for yagef-bagep: the drudor pelius courier leaves the kasdor zorvan norir ledger at gate 8016 under passcode 755406

## Onboarding: snapshot tests for Plumelight components

Hey reviewer! Our UI snapshots live under `__frames__/` and regenerate via `plume snap --update`. Please reject PRs that bulk-update snapshots without an explanation — that's how visual regressions sneak into Kestrel Deck. Snapshots upload to the Marrowby artifact store on CI, which means your local env file needs the store credential; it goes on the very next line.

vault entry, yahif-yajep: COURIER_KEY29=b802bdf8034096b65a51c6ba5abe2

## Changelog 1.7.0 — Reconciliation Job Defaults

The Stockmere inventory reconciliation job now runs every four hours instead of nightly, and mismatches above the tolerance threshold page the on-call rotation rather than silently logging. Batch size was reduced to keep warehouse DB load flat. New team members should not override these without lead approval. The current defaults are as follows.

config for bagep-kageg:
ULADOR_LOG_LEVEL=warn
ULADOR_METRICS_HOST=metrics.ulador.tolvaqcorp.corp
ULADOR_POOL_SIZE=32